My thoughts on the game tonight and what I would like to see.
Obviously, we need to limit turnovers to avoid giving up easy looks in transition. We also MUST win the rebounding battle. If we lose the battle on the boards tonight, that will mean we are getting completely out hustled. That is a recipe for a home blowout loss.
If I were making the gameplan:
Offensively:
I would have us drive, drive, drive some more. This does a few things: 1) Gives us what should be better looks at the basket and takes advantage of our athleticism and our length 2) Should limit long rebounds which lets Auburn get out in transition 3) Will allow us to hit the offensive glass very hard 4) could help us get them in foul trouble early. 5) Get some easy open 3 point looks from kick outs; after beating them off the dribble and they help down.
When we aren’t driving we need to pound the ball in the paint. Also, not just to Hall. We need to post up Petty, and Dazon some (if he plays) Posting up Dazon May help limit his turnovers. We have a size and length advantage with our guards. We need to use it and get physical with them.
Defensively:
Get physical with them. We have a size advantage we need to use it. I would like to see Herb on Harper some. (I know we tried it some early last time, but the game snowballed on us so quickly that it didn’t matter) Have Petty guard Brown often. Again, I want length on their guards.
This also sounds crazy as well as they shoot the ball, but I would mix in some zone too. This should help limit getting beat off of the dribble. We are long enough that we can get into the shooters faces. (Actually as long as we are we should actually play a 2-3 zone more often)
